The Lampertz Efficiency Room (LER) is Rittal’s latest generation of IT security room infrastructure, designed to enable organisations maximise the efficiency and security of their data centre operations.

The infrastructure encompasses systems to protect against fire, water, dust and burglary risks and can be customised to individual user requirements and delivered to organisations in less than a month.

Operating inside the LER is the RimatriX5 system that provides a modular and scalable IT infrastructure solutions for racks, power, cooling, security, monitoring and remote management within data centres.

The intent of the infrastructure is to assist businesses that are under pressures to transform their data centre infrastructure into an asset that improves IT efficiency, drives down operating costs and addresses their carbon footprint.
